Padmini Ekadasi also called Kamala Ekadasi was first observed by Padmini, King Kartavirya’s queen and hence the name.
She underwent severe rituals on the day and Lord Vishnu blessed her with all that she wanted in her case a son. Rituals and ceremonies on the day also wash away sins – past and present life and lead one to Vaikunta, the abode of Lord Vishnu. Padmini Ekadasi falls during Shukla Paksha in the Ashada month, May 25, 2018.
